Abstract
This paper dealing with the problem of modeling an Electro Power Steering System. We introduce a new position model reference structure composed of two inter-connected models. The first model, is a torque booster stage modeled by an hydraulic-like power steering unit providing the total desired steering torque. The second model is a mechanical model providing the desired drive wheel angle, and including a desired tire/road stiffness. This is a two-part paper, the second part (in the same proceedings) presents the corresponding control design and uses the model presented in this paper as a reference one.
